Anchored in Louisville's urban core, this district delivered a 26.3-point Democratic presidential margin in 2024, making it an outlier in a state that has shifted sharply Republican at nearly every other level.
Across the recorded series it reached a Democratic high of 29.7 points in 1892 and a Republican high of 26.3 points in 1972. Between 2020 and 2024 the district moved 2.7 points toward the Democratic candidate; the 2024 margin was 26.3 points.
A population of 47,116, a 66% non-Hispanic-white share, and a median household income of $62,653 describe the district. The district's voting pattern over the last decade is most similar to that of State House District 74 and State House District 34.

How did Kentucky 76th State House District vote in 2024?
In 2024, Kentucky 76th State House District voted Democratic by 26.3 points (D+26.3), carried by the Democratic candidate. Out of 20,728 votes cast, 12,886 went Democratic and 7,430 went Republican.
When did Kentucky 76th State House District last vote Republican?
The most recent presidential election in which Kentucky 76th State House District voted Republican was 1988.
How many people live in Kentucky 76th State House District?
Kentucky 76th State House District has a population of 47,116 according to the 2024 American Community Survey 5-year estimates from the US Census Bureau.
What is the median household income in Kentucky 76th State House District?
Median household income in Kentucky 76th State House District is $62,653 — below the national median of $80,734. The Kentucky state median is $63,726.
What is the political history of Kentucky 76th State House District?
Akashic tracks 38 presidential elections in Kentucky 76th State House District from 1876 to 2024. Of those, 28 went Democratic and 10 went Republican.
